Catchavibe will play on the Fourth
Maine reggae band Catchavibe will bring its brand of reggae fusion with deep grooves that inspire dancing to Turner’s community gazebo on Wednesday, July 4. The band of accomplished international musicians, songwriters, producers and master teachers includes Baraka Oyuru, percussion, keys and vocals; Mai Kheet, drums and vocals; Craig Raymond, guitar; Supra Dread, MC controller; and Wells Gordon, bass. Catchavibe will play after the 10 a.m. parade, from 11 a.m. to 1 p.m. Bring a lawn chair. July Fourth festivities at the nearby Turner Public Library will include strawberry shortcake, book sales, face-painting and more. Turner Community Church will host a chicken barbecue.
